About this eBook

Irresistibly cute baby hats with matching booties, in styles today's knitters will love.

BabyKnits Hats & Booties presents fifteen matching sets - thirty projects - to warm little heads and tootsies. Such sets have always been popular projects, the perfect gift for a newborn. These original patterns include both contemporary classics (like baby cables or wiggly stripes) and whimsical creations (like dots and ruffles). The matching booties share the same yarns and styling. The patterns use easy stitches and widely available yarns including bright cottons, soft baby weights, and novelty yarns. There are earflaps and curlicue tops and rosebuds. These projects will knit up quickly in time for a baby shower, and will be treasured by the lucky baby's family forever.

About the author

Edie Eckman, author of Quick-to-Knit Baby Hats & Socks, is the former owner of a yarn shop. She teaches knitting and crochet design classes at conferences and knitting guilds throughout the United States. Her designs and techniques have been published in a variety of magazines and booklets. She lives in Waynesboro, Virginia.
